Oral-Systemic Connections

How the plaque on your teeth may be connected to plaque in your arteries

Several cohort studies have shown that periodontal disease is associated with an increased risk of stroke [2–5]. A recent meta-analysis of 2 cohort studies found that periodontal disease increased the risk of ischemic stroke by 1.6-fold [6]. Gum disease may increase your risk of colorectal cancer.

new study, published in Cancer Prevention Research, included 42,486 men and women participating in two large continuing health surveys. Over the past several decades, the participants had periodically reported information on health and diet, including reports of gingivitis and tooth loss.

Stroke

Stroke

Studies show that having gum disease doubles your chances of suffering a stroke. Bleeding gums and inflammation from gum disease can lead to changes in the flow of blood and oxygen to the brain. A reduction or blockage of blood flow and oxygen to the brain leads to a stroke.

Colon Rectal Cancer

Colon Rectal Cancer

The oral periodontopathic bacterium Fusobacterium nucleate has been repeatedly associated with colorectal tumors. F. nucleatum and Porphyromonas gingivalis have identified several virulence mechanisms that promote both bacterial survival and carcinogenesis.

Compromised Diabetic Function

Compromised Diabetic Function

If you’re living with diabetes, your immune system isn’t as strong as you might like it to be. That makes you more susceptible to gum disease. The worst part about gum disease is that it can raise your blood sugar. And that makes it harder to control diabetes.

Diseases of the Gum Line

When the studies of Oral-Systemic health (OSH) determined that gum disease-causing bacteria found in the gum line were related to diabetes, Alzheimer’s Disease (AD), Cardiovascular Disease (CVD), and stroke, PerioAlert became an essential component of diagnosing periodontal disease (PD).

About 700 kinds of microorganisms exist in the human mouth, and these microbes constitute the human oral microbiota. It is one of the most complex microbial communities in the human body.

There is evidence that oral microbiota is also closely related to systemic diseases including rheumatoid arthritis (RA), adverse pregnancy outcomes, stroke, and cardiovascular disease.
